NVIDIA Cosmos

Product Details

NVIDIA Cosmos is an advanced world-based model platform designed to accelerate the development of physical AI systems such as autonomous vehicles and robots. It provides a series of pre-trained generative models, advanced tokenizers and accelerated data processing pipelines, making it easier for developers to build and optimize physics AI applications. Cosmos reduces development costs and improves development efficiency through its open model license, and is suitable for enterprises and research institutions of all sizes.

Main Features

1
Provides pre-trained world base models for generating physically aware videos and world states
2
Supports multi-modal inputs such as images, text, and videos to produce high-quality output
3
Has built-in security safeguards like brand filtering and harmful content detection
4
Accelerate data processing and cleaning, improve data preparation efficiency
5
Support the development and fine-tuning of custom models to meet specific application needs
6
Integrates with NVIDIA Omniverse to support multiverse simulations and real-time decision-making

Target Users

Suitable for developers in the fields of autonomous vehicles, robotics and visual AI, helping them quickly build and optimize physical AI systems.

Examples

Self-driving vehicle development: Use Cosmos to generate synthetic data of various driving scenarios for training and testing self-driving models.

Robot simulation: Use video data generated by Cosmos to predict robot behavior and optimize decision-making.

Visual AI applications: Use high-quality videos generated by Cosmos to improve the accuracy of visual recognition and analysis.

NVIDIA Project DIGITS

NVIDIA Project DIGITS

NVIDIA Project DIGITS is a desktop supercomputer powered by the NVIDIA GB10 Grace Blackwell superchip, designed to deliver powerful AI performance to AI developers. It delivers one petaflop of AI performance in a power-efficient, compact form factor. The product comes pre-installed with the NVIDIA AI software stack and comes with 128GB of memory, enabling developers to prototype, fine-tune and infer large AI models of up to 200 billion parameters locally and seamlessly deploy to the data center or cloud. The launch of Project DIGITS marks another important milestone in NVIDIA’s drive to advance AI development and innovation, providing developers with a powerful tool to accelerate the development and deployment of AI models.

EXAONE-3.5-7.8B-Instruct-AWQ

EXAONE-3.5-7.8B-Instruct-AWQ

EXAONE 3.5 is a series of instruction-tuned bilingual (English and Korean) generative models developed by LG AI Research, with parameters ranging from 2.4B to 32B. These models support long context processing up to 32K tokens and demonstrate state-of-the-art performance on real-world use cases and long context understanding, while remaining competitive in the general domain compared to recently released models of similar size. EXAONE 3.5 models include: 1) 2.4B model, optimized for deployment on small or resource-constrained devices; 2) 7.8B model, matching the size of the previous generation model but offering improved performance; 3) 32B model, delivering powerful performance.
